Ferragamo, an epitome of Italian luxury, was founded by Salvatore Ferragamo in 1920s Florence. Originally crafting shoes, Salvatore’s unique designs quickly garnered acclaim. The brand evolved, offering exquisite leather goods, elegant apparel, and sophisticated accessories. Ferragamo’s legacy is rooted in unparalleled craftsmanship and timeless style, reflecting a dedication to artisanal perfection and innovative fashion.

Meaning and history

Ferragamo Logo history

Ferragamo’s journey began in the 1920s with Salvatore Ferragamo, a visionary shoemaker in Florence, Italy. His exceptional designs captivated Hollywood’s elite, making Ferragamo synonymous with cinematic glamour. Post-World War II, the brand diversified, introducing handbags, silk scarves, and ready-to-wear collections. The 1950s saw the debut of iconic creations like the “Vara” pump. Salvatore’s passing in 1960 led his family to helm the brand, furthering its global presence. The 1970s and 1980s marked expansion into fragrances and eyewear, enhancing its luxury portfolio. The 1990s focused on sustainability, blending tradition with innovation.

Ferragamo upholds its heritage of exquisite craftsmanship, with a commitment to contemporary design and sustainable luxury. The brand, a symbol of Italian elegance, continues to influence the fashion world with its timeless designs and innovative spirit.

1927 – 1930

Salvatore Ferragamo Logo 1927

The logo showcases the name “Calzaturificio Ferragamo & C.” in a classic, serif font, conveying time-honored elegance. The text is fluid, suggesting the brand’s seamless blend of traditional craftsmanship with artistic flair. The typography is confident, hinting at the brand’s established history and prestige in luxury fashion. The inclusion of “& C.” nods to a heritage of collaboration, possibly referencing the family or team behind the label. This logo evokes the sophistication and high standards synonymous with Ferragamo’s identity.

1930 – 1948

Salvatore Ferragamo Logo 1930

This evolved logo features bold, angular contrasts, with “FERRAGAMO’S” prominently breaking through the center in sharp, dynamic lettering. “CREATIONS” is perched above, suggesting a focus on inventive designs. “FLORENCE ITALY” anchors the design, grounding the brand’s identity in its prestigious locale. The stark black and white palette underscores the logo’s modernist edge. Overall, it reflects a shift towards a more avant-garde, assertive branding, embodying Ferragamo’s progressive spirit in fashion.

1948 – 1951

Salvatore Ferragamo Logo 1948

The logo transitions to a fluid, cursive script, “Salvatore Ferragamo,” which exudes personal touch and elegance. Gone are the stark contrasts and geometrics, replaced by smooth, flowing lines that suggest exclusivity and sophistication. This handwritten style imparts a sense of bespoke luxury, reflecting the brand’s commitment to personal craftsmanship and high fashion. It signals a move towards a more personalized, high-end brand image.

1951 – 1960

Salvatore Ferragamo Logo 1951

This rendition of the Ferragamo logo reintroduces bold, angular elements, with “FERRAGAMO” taking center stage in stark, impactful lettering. “SALVATORE” is subtly included, acknowledging the founder’s personal legacy. “FLORENCE” and “MADE IN ITALY” underline the brand’s proud heritage and commitment to Italian craftsmanship. The design retains the modernist flair of previous logos while emphasizing the brand’s origins and artisanal quality.

1960 – 1982

Salvatore Ferragamo Logo 1960

The logo reverts to a personalized signature style, showcasing “Salvatore Ferragamo” in elegant cursive. This design emphasizes a return to the brand’s artisanal roots, highlighting the personal touch of its founder. The fluidity of the script speaks of the brand’s commitment to grace and finesse, shedding the previous logo’s geometric boldness for a more intimate and refined elegance. This change symbolizes a dedication to individuality and high-end bespoke fashion.

1982 – 2022

Salvatore Ferragamo Logo 1982

The logo preserves the cursive signature style but with enhanced boldness in “Salvatore Ferragamo.” The designer’s name is more pronounced, with thicker strokes and a more assertive presence. This reflects the brand’s growing confidence and prominence in the luxury market. The elongated tail of the “o” in “Ferragamo” adds a distinctive flourish, hinting at the brand’s attention to detail and flair for the dramatic.

2022 – Today

Fergamo Logo

The logo has transitioned to a minimalist, sans-serif font, spelling “FERRAGAMO.” It’s a stark shift from cursive elegance to modern simplicity. The uniformity of the letters suggests a contemporary, clean, and accessible brand image. This design speaks to a forward-thinking approach, embracing a more streamlined and versatile identity. The focus is solely on the brand name, reinforcing its strength and recognition in the luxury fashion industry.
